How to Know When Your Roof Needs to be Replaced

  1. Noticeable water damage 
  2. Stained of sagging ceilings inside your home
  3. Dark streaks on the roof from bacteria build-up 
  4. Misaligned or missing shingles
  5. Old, worn and decaying shingles 
  6. Dysfunctional gutters, clogged or overflowing
  7. Loose or missing flashing which surrounds chimneys and other roof penetrations
